‘Star Trek’ Actress Nichelle Nichols Resting Comfortably After Stroke

Nichelle Nichols, best known for playing Lieutenant Uhura in Star Trek, was rushed to a hospital Wednesday night after suffering a mild stroke, reports TMZ.
A rep for the actress says she’s awake and resting comfortably at an L.A. hospital. The 82-year-old was taken by ambulance from her home Wednesday night.
Doctors are conducting tests to determine the severity of the stroke.
Nichols appeared on both the Star Trek TV show and six of the films, the last one being Star Trek VI: The Undiscovered Country.
